原文:Vue父組件如何調用子組件(彈出框)中的方法的問題

如果子組件是一個彈出框,只有在觸發某個點擊事件時彈出框才能出現 也就是說在父組件中的子組件使用上用了v if ,那在父組件上如果不點擊彈出框是不能獲取到 ref的。 原因就是:引用指向的是子組件創建的實例,可以理解為綁在了DOM結構上那如果我偏偏想調用的是這個子組件 彈出框 中的方法,但又不想要彈出框顯示,怎么辦呢 解決方法:把v if換成v show,這樣DOM元素會一直存在於父組件中,子組件的 ...

2019-06-08 11:39 0 2550 推薦指數:

查看詳情

Vue 組件調用組件方法

qwq 前兩天看了下vue,父子組件方法調用,怕忘記,所以做個小記錄。 一.組件調用組件方法 1.組件 <template> <div id="rightmenu8"> <rightmenu7 ref ...

Fri Apr 13 16:43:00 CST 2018 0 3012
vue組件調用組件方法

組件中子組件標簽上設置ref,利用this.$refs.refName.xxx()可以調用組件的xxx方法 注意:ref是很牛逼的,甚至可以這樣設置: 爺爺組件控制孫子組件的name屬性,但是最好不要這樣干,不利於理解數據流 ...

Wed Sep 16 21:50:00 CST 2020 0 1437
Vue 組件調用組件方法

組件 <template> <div> <uuu ref='test_hanshu'></uuu> //ref 給組件命名一個名字 <p @click="clickme">點擊我</p> ...

Sun Sep 20 02:56:00 CST 2020 0 1308
Vue組件調用組件方法

Vue中子組件調用組件方法,這里有三種方法提供參考 第一種方法是直接在組件通過this.$parent.event來調用組件方法 組件 組件 第二種方法是在組件里用$emit向組件觸發一個事件,組件監聽這個事件 ...

Thu Aug 23 22:56:00 CST 2018 11 109492
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M